태그 보관물: url

url

도메인 이름의 대소 문자를 정의 할 수 있습니까? 도메인 (웹 플랫폼 Altervista.org)을 구입하고

.com확장명을 가진 두 번째 수준 도메인 (웹 플랫폼 Altervista.org)을 구입하고 싶습니다 . 도메인 확인 프로세스 내에서 대문자와 소문자로 문자를 입력 할 수 있기 때문에 URL에서 문자가 대문자 및 / 또는 또는 이전에 선택한대로 소문자입니다.

예를 들어, “MyWebSite”라는 이름을 원하고 도메인 등록 프로세스 중에 “MyWebSite”를 선택한다고 가정 해 보겠습니다. 최종 URL은 www.MyWebSite.com또는 www.mywebsite.com?

그래서, 내 질문은 : 캔 도메인 이름 에 모두 표시 상단 또는 소문자 에서 문자 URL 과의 검색 엔진 웹 마스터의 이전 선택에 따라 결과?



답변

아니요, 등록하는 동안 선택한 대소 문자에 관계없이 도메인의 최종 대소 문자 형식에 영향을 미치지 않습니다.

DNS (Domain Name System) 이름은 대소 문자를 구분하지 않으므로 등록 할 때 또는 “잘 생긴”목적으로 검색 엔진에 정의 할 때이 이름을 조작 할 수 없습니다.

브라우저 나 FTP 클라이언트 소프트웨어, 이메일 클라이언트 소프트웨어 또는 링크에 입력 할 때 모든 경우 (상단 및 하한)가 허용됩니다.

Internet Engineering Task Force 웹 사이트 에서 DNS 표준에 대한 모든 대소 문자 무감도 설명을 읽을 수 있습니다


답변

DNS 자체는 대소 문자를 구분하지 않지만 하나 이상의 검색 엔진을 사용하면 검색 결과에서 선호 사례를 선언 할 수 있습니다 : Yandex.

사이트 이름의 케이스 도구를 사용하면 어떤 경우에 선호 총액을 설정할 수 있습니다. Yandex.WebmasterAppearance in search results> 에서 액세스 할 수 있습니다 URL letter case.

내 사이트 중 일부에 대해 이것을 설정했으며 매우 좋습니다.


답변

기술적으로는 어떤 경우에도 도메인을 등록 할 수 있습니다. 그러나 기록을 위해 브라우저에 도메인을 입력하는 방법에 관계없이 작은 경우로 변환됩니다. DNS는 대소 문자를 구분하지 않기 때문입니다.

이 말이 있다면 … www.YAhOO.com다르지 없어야합니다 www.yahoo.com또는 www.yAhOo.com당신은 당신의 브라우저의 주소 표시 줄을 주위 재생이 일어날 것을 볼 수있다 ….

링크 를 통해 개념을 더 잘 이해할 수 있습니다.


답변

다른 답변에서 언급했듯이 DNS는 대소 문자를 구분하지 않지만 여기서는 거의 중요하지 않습니다. 동일한 IP에서 일부 요청에 대해 HTTP 404 페이지를 제공하고 다른 요청에 대해서는 HTTP 200 페이지를 제공 할 수 있습니다.

Host대문자를 기반으로 HTTP 헤더 및 서버의 다른 컨텐츠를 확인할 수 있습니다 . 대문자가 정확하지 않은 경우 404 페이지 또는 리디렉션을 제공 할 수 있습니다.

그러나 AFAIK의 모든 일반 브라우저는 URL의 도메인 부분을 소문자로 변환하고 (아마도 l 대신 I (자본 i)와 같은 유사한 문자로 도메인을 등록하지 못하도록 보호하고 호스트 헤더의 모든 소문자 값을 보냅니다) 따라서 브라우저에서 무한 리다이렉션이 발생하지만 HTTP에 대해서는 이론적으로 아무것도하지 않습니다. 브라우저 제한 사항입니다.